Intern Spotlight: Koby Nachtigal
Jul 15, 2026
Get to know Koby Nachtigal, the agronomy sales intern from Aurora, Nebraska!
Koby graduated from Southeast Community College in May.
Why did you choose to intern at Farmers Cooperative?
I chose Farmers Cooperative because I thought that they’d be the best at helping me learn more and further my knowledge and skills in agronomy.
What has been the best part of your internship so far?
The best part of the internship so far has just been getting in the fields and scouting for different farmers.
What are the day-to-day tasks in your role?
The day-to-day tasks are learning about all of the agronomy products and services, as well as how to properly recommend and provide them to customers through the sales team. I will also help monitor test plots and research projects, as well as support the day-to-day operations in Raymond. I also do some crop scouting, tissue sampling, custom application, precision agriculture, and other agronomy tasks.
What is your summer internship project?
My project is creating chemical plans for post-emergence applications in corn and soybean fields. I help determine the best herbicide recommendations for weed control and use the results to develop application plans that help farmers manage their crops throughout the growing season.
